5.6 Default Settings
The Default Settings Table shows all of the System Configuration settings and the remaining settings that are enabled, or turned on, when
the FP-5000 leaves the factory. If the user reverts back to the default settings at any time when the unit is installed in the field, the FP-5000
will revert back to the settings in this table.
Table 5.11 System Config
System Config System Config Settings Default Setting
Frequency: 60
Phase Seq: ABC
CT Connect: 3-wire
PH CT Ratio: 500:5
IX CT Ratio: 500:5
VT Connect: Wye
Main VTR: 100
Aux VTR: 100
Prim Units: No
I/O Config: Default
Prog Logic: Default
Remote Set: Enable
Prg w/Bkr: Either
Remote Bkr: Disable
# Set Grps: 1
Set Ctrl: Local
Disarm Ctrl: Disable
Energy Unit: kWh
TOC Reset T: 5
Bkr Oper PB: Disable
5.5.10 Change Password
The factory default password is 0000. A password of 0000 will
always be accepted during the first 2 minutes after the FP-5000 is
powered up. This allows the user to enter a new password, in case
the password is forgotten.
To change the password, select Change Password setting in the
“Setting Main” display window. Use the single arrow up/down
pushbuttons to move among the 4-character locations of the
password and use the double arrow pushbuttons to change the
value of the 4-character password. Zero through nine and A to Z
are available for each password character.
If the user presses Enter for the password window without changing
any password character the default password of 0 is accepted. The
user can change the password to any non-zero values. However, if
the user changes the password to any non-zero values, pressing
Enter will not permit entry to the settings or the test functions. The
correct password has to be entered.
The same password is valid for setting mode as well as the
test mode.
The FP-5000 password is not valid for PowerNet. PowerNet has its
own password scheme.
